5F820 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: 5F - HR F: Error Messages (France)

  • Message number: 820

  • Message text: No update required. Claim &1 is consistent.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message 5F820 - No update required. Claim &1 is consistent. ?
    The SAP error message "5F820 No update required. Claim &1 is consistent." typically indicates that the system has determined that no updates are necessary for the specified claim (denoted by &1). This message is often related to processes involving claims management, such as insurance claims or other financial claims within the SAP system.
    
    Cause: Claim Consistency: The claim in question has been validated and found to be consistent with the current data. This means that the system has checked the claim against the relevant criteria and determined that no changes or updates are needed. Data Integrity: The data associated with the claim is already in the correct state, and any attempted updates would not alter the claim's status or information. Business Logic: The business rules defined in the SAP system may dictate that certain claims do not require updates under specific conditions.
